ZIP code 06374 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in Plainfield, Windham County, Connecticut, home to 8,373 residents across 67.1 square miles, a density of 125 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.

ZIP 06374 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$71,882 (36% below the Connecticut average), while per-capita income is $35,464. Local economic indicators show a 9.0% poverty rate alongside 5.4% unemployment. On housing, the median home value is $248,700 (43% below the state average) with median rent at $1,302 per month, and 72.1% of occupied units are owner-occupied.

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 15.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 42.7, and the average commute is 30 minutes. Home values in ZIP 06374 have increased 10.7%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+142% cumulative appreciation.

Census Bureau data shows 192 business establishments in ZIP 06374, employing approximately 2,954 people with a combined annual payroll of $125,516,000.
